reign英英释义

noun

royal authority : sovereignty

under the reign of the Stuart kings

the dominion, sway, or influence of one resembling a monarch

the reign of the Puritan ministers

the time during which someone (such as a sovereign) reigns

verb

intransitive verb

to possess or exercise sovereign power : rule

to hold office as chief of state although possessing little governing power

in England the sovereign reigns but does not rule

to exercise authority in the manner of a monarch

to be predominant or prevalent

chaos reigned in the classroom

reign词源中文解释

13世纪早期, regne,“由君主统治的王国,国家”(现已过时),源自古法语 reigne “王国,土地,国家”(现代法语 règne),源自拉丁语 regnum “国王,统治,领域”,与 regere “统治,指导,保持直线,引导”相关(源自 PIE 根 *reg- “沿直线移动”,具有指导沿直线移动的派生词,因此意为“领导,统治”)。

从14世纪后期开始,“主权,王权,统治”等意义。因此,通常指“像国王一样的权力,影响或支配”(自1725年起)。用于约会的“君主占据王位的时间段”的含义记录于14世纪中期。

reign词源英文解释

Noun Middle English regne, from Anglo-French, from Latin regnum, from reg-, rex king — more at royal

The first known use of reign was in the 13th century
